Shu‐Li Yao is a scholar working on Inorganic Chemistry, Materials Chemistry and Spectroscopy.
According to data from OpenAlex, Shu‐Li Yao has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 30 papers in Inorganic Chemistry, 26 papers in Materials Chemistry and 21 papers in Spectroscopy. Recurrent topics in Shu‐Li Yao’s work include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(30 papers), Molecular Sensors and Ion Detection (21 papers) and Magnetism in coordination complexes (10 papers). Shu‐Li Yao is often cited by papers focused on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(30 papers), Molecular Sensors and Ion Detection (21 papers) and Magnetism in coordination complexes (10 papers). Shu‐Li Yao collaborates with scholars based in China and United States. Shu‐Li Yao's co-authors include Sui‐Jun Liu, Teng‐Fei Zheng, He‐Rui Wen, Jing‐Lin Chen and Xue‐Mei Tian and has published in prestigious journals such as Inorganic Chemistry, Applied Surface Science and Journal of Alloys and Compounds.
